Beginning Linux Programming
Neil Matthew & Richard Stones
Unix Power Tools
Shelley Powers, Jerry Peek, Tim O'Reilly & Mike Loukides
Python Machine Learning by Example
Yuxi (Hayden) Liu
Applied Cryptography
Bruce Schneier
Red Hat Enterprise Linux 7: Desktops and Administration
Richard Petersen